Full Job Description
Responsibilities
  • Lead and grow the production firmware organization, including technical direction, execution planning, mentoring, hiring, and performance management.
  • Drive firmware strategy and roadmap in partnership with product management, silicon, hardware, AI software, and system architecture teams.
  • Define product requirements, firmware architecture, development milestones, and release plans for embedded AI products from concept through production.
  • Own firmware project execution, including planning, prioritization, risk management, resource allocation, schedule tracking, and cross-functional coordination.
  • Translate product and customer requirements into scalable firmware solutions that enable high-performance embedded AI platforms.
  • Oversee the design, development, integration, and optimization of embedded software for real-time and AI-driven applications.
  • Guide firmware development for FPGA and ASIC platforms, ensuring robust hardware/software integration and successful product bring-up.
  • Lead the development of firmware, device drivers, and platform software supporting machine learning acceleration on embedded hardware.
  • Drive system-level optimization for performance, latency, power efficiency, reliability, and manufacturability.
  • Collaborate with engineering leadership to establish development processes, coding standards, quality metrics, CI/CD, testing, and release practices for production firmware.
  • Support customer engagements, product launches, and field issue resolution as required.

Requirements
  • BS or MS in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or a related field with 8+ years of embedded systems experience, including technical leadership or engineering management responsibilities.
  • Proven experience leading firmware teams through complete product development cycles from definition to commercial deployment.
  • Demonstrated experience driving cross-functional projects involving hardware, silicon, software, AI, and product management teams.
  • Experience defining product requirements, development roadmaps, engineering schedules, and execution plans.
  • Strong understanding of embedded firmware architecture for microcontroller- and SoC-based systems.
  • Experience with RTOS-based firmware architectures and integration (e.g., Zephyr, FreeRTOS).
  • Solid understanding of low-level software, device drivers, hardware interfaces, and system bring-up.
  • Proficiency in C/C++ with sufficient technical depth to provide architectural guidance and conduct design reviews.
  • Experience delivering production firmware for commercial embedded products.
  • Strong project management, communication, and stakeholder management skills with the ability to balance technical excellence, product priorities, and delivery schedules.
  • Experience working in a fast-paced startup environment with the ability to manage multiple concurrent projects.
  • Hands-on debugging and performance optimization experience is a plus.

Salary Range: $230,000 - $300,000 / year
